Holiday Sugar Cookies - cooking recipe

Ingredients
    8 Tbsp. (4 oz.) butter, softened
    2 large eggs
    1 tsp. vanilla
    2 1/2 c. all-purpose flour
    1/4 tsp. salt
    1 c. sugar
    2 Tbsp. milk
    grated rind of 1 lemon
    1 1/2 tsp. baking powder
    2 Tbsp. superfine sugar
Preparation
    Heat oven to 375\u00b0.
    Lightly butter 2 baking sheets.
    Beat the butter and sugar in a large bowl until light and creamy.
    In a separate bowl combine the eggs, milk, vanilla and lemon rind. Sift together the flour, baking powder and salt.
    Gradually add the egg-milk mixture to the creamed butter, alternating with the sifted dry ingredients.
    Blend well after each addition.
    Divide the dough into 4 pieces and put each on a large piece of wax paper or aluminum foil.
    Shape the dough into cylinders about 2 inches thick.
    Wrap each cylinder well and chill for 2 hours or until very firm.
    Cut the dough cylinders into slices about 1/4-inch thick and put them on the baking sheets about 1 inch apart.
    Bake for 10 minutes until the cookies are very lightly browned. Sprinkle the cookies with superfine sugar and cool on wire racks. Makes 4 dozen cookies.
